Pull request overview
This PR establishes comprehensive security audit framework and zero-trust admin access documentation for HIPAA-compliant production operations. It addresses the need for formal HIPAA compliance audit documentation, just-in-time admin access controls, third-party audit processes, and a security hardening roadmap with actionable outcomes.
Key Changes
- HIPAA Compliance Documentation: Comprehensive audit report documenting 100% compliance with HIPAA Security Rule (18/18 standards), including automated and manual validation tests, gap analysis, and remediation plans
- Zero-Trust Architecture: Complete implementation guide for Azure AD Privileged Identity Management (PIM), eliminating 8 permanent admin accounts in favor of JIT activation with 4-8 hour time-bound access
- Audit Framework: Third-party audit process documentation covering 5 audit types (HIPAA, penetration testing, SOC 2, vulnerability assessment, code review) with preparation checklists, RFP templates, and remediation workflows
- 12-Month Security Roadmap: Prioritized plan with 12 initiatives, $127K budget, 2,808 hours effort, targeting security posture improvement from 8.3/10 to 9.5/10 with 582% ROI
